First the good. Uploading an image was quite easy, just MAKE SURE that any portion of the desired image that needs to be transparent (allowing the color of the T-Shirt to show through) is actually transparent and not white. The size & placement of the image was where it needed to be and the final printed image was of good quality with easy to read text. All in all, a quality print.
Now the Bad. The heavy cotton shirt was mad by Gildan. After 1 or 2 washings this T-Shirt is now a size smaller, especially in length. What started out as a shirt extending down to my hip is now a shirt that barely gets down to the waist; this was after a couple of washings in cold water. If there was an option to specify a "Tall" size then it would be advisable but there's not.
